If you are in the teaching practice for the first time its normal to feel that you are lost but here are some simple tips from my experiences might help you:




1.Be provisional by coming to the school on the time or before the time if you have lessons so you can prepare your activities.




2. When you feel that you are lost it is better to observe and take notes that make your understanding of the lesson structure and what is happening easy.

3. If you are teaching KG students try to make the activities as simple as you can with dividing the instructions in the steps where the children can follow step one and apply it then they follow step two and so on.

  4. Make your language in the appropriate level for the children to understand.

    5. Support your language with gestures, flash cards, actions and pictures.

  6. When you read a story use change your voice to fit with the different characters.

   7. Make sure that when you read a story that you are in good place where everyone can see the book.

  8. When you are explaining the next activity make sure that the students got the idea by asking one of them to say what they should do and ask another one so everyone understands.

9. Try to provide interactive activity where the children play in groups or peers.
10. Use different strategies to manage the students behavior such as smile faces.
